明确需求与规划
1. 确定目标:明确你想要制作的动态网站的目的和功能。
2. 市场调研:了解同类型网站的特点和用户需求。
3. 规划网站结构:设计网站的整体框架和内容布局。
学习基础网站制作知识
1. HTML:学习基础的结构标签和语义化标签。
2. CSS:了解样式表的编写,掌握基本的布局和美化技巧。
3. JavaScript:学习交互逻辑的编写,为动态效果打下基础。
选择合适的开发工具
1. 文本编辑器:如Notepad++、Sublime Text等,用于编写代码。
2. 浏览器:如Chrome、Firefox等,用于预览和测试网站。
3. 框架或CMS:如WordPress、Drupal等,可以简化开发过程。
搭建动态网站基础架构
1. 服务器环境搭建:安装Web服务器(如Apache、Nginx)和数据库(如MySQL)。
2. 编写后端代码:使用PHP、Python等语言编写处理动态内容的逻辑。
3. 连接数据库:将后端代码与数据库连接,实现数据的增删改查功能。
实现动态功能
1. 用户认证与授权:实现用户注册、登录及权限管理功能。
2. 数据展示:通过前端技术将数据库中的数据展示在网页上。
3. 交互逻辑:利用JavaScript实现表单验证、点击事件等交互功能。
前端界面开发
1. 设计页面布局:使用HTML和CSS设计网页的结构和样式。
2. 添加动态元素:利用JavaScript和AJAX等技术实现动态加载和交互效果。
3. 响应式设计:确保网站在不同设备上都能良好地显示和使用。
测试与调试
1. 功能测试:测试网站的各项功能是否正常工作。
2. 兼容性测试:确保网站在不同浏览器和设备上都能正常显示。
3. 性能优化:对网站进行性能优化,提高加载速度和响应速度。
上线与维护
1. 域名与主机:购买域名和主机空间,将网站部署到服务器上。
2. SEO优化:对网站进行搜索引擎优化,提高网站的曝光率。
3. 定期维护:定期检查网站的运行状况,修复漏洞和错误。